发明名称 METHODS, SYSTEMS, AND MEDIA FOR INHIBITING ATTACKS ON EMBEDDED DEVICES
摘要 Methods, systems, and media for inhibiting attacks on embedded devices are provided. In some embodiments, a system fur inhibiting on embedded devices is provided, the system comprises a processor that is configured to: identify an embedded device that is configured to provide one or more services to one or more digital processing devices within a communications network; receive a first firmware associated with the embedded device; generate a second firmware that is functionally equivalent to the first firmware by: determining unused code within the first firmware; removing the unused code within the second firmware; and restructuring remaining code portions of the first firmware into memory positions within the second firmware; and inject the second firmware into the embedded device.
申请公布号 US2017099302(A1) 申请公布日期 2017.04.06
申请号 US201615136581 申请日期 2016.04.22
申请人 THE TRUSTEES OF COLUMBIA UNIVERSITY IN THE CITY OF NEW YORK 发明人 Cui Ang;Stolfo Salvatore J.
分类号 H04L29/06;G06F21/57 主分类号 H04L29/06
代理机构 代理人
主权项 1. A system for inhibiting attacks on embedded devices, the system comprising a processor configured to: identify an embedded device that is configured to provide one or more services to one or more digital processing devices within a communications network; receive a first firmware associated with the embedded device; generate a second firmware that is functionally equivalent to the first firmware by: determining unused code within the first firmware;removing the unused code within the second firmware to create free memory locations; andusing the free memory locations to restructure remaining program instructions from the first firmware into memory positions within the second firmware and insert at least one defensive payload and at least one policy; and inject the second firmware into the embedded device.
地址 NEW YORK NY US